Precisa XS125A Analytical Balance
| Brand | Precisa |
|---|---|
| Model | XS125A |
| Weighing Range | 125 g |
| Readability | 0.1 mg |
| Taring Range | 125 g |
| Reproducibility | ≤0.1 mg |
| Linearity Error | ±0.2 mg |
| Response Time | 2–4 s |
| Stability Adjustment | 3-step adjustable |
| Operating Temperature | 0–40 °C |
| Sensitivity Drift (10–30 °C) | ±2 ppm/°C |
| Power Supply | 115/230 V AC, 50–60 Hz |
| Power Consumption | 6 VA |
| Display | Fluorescent (optional) |
| Dimensions (L×W×H) | 210 × 340 × 345 mm |
| Pan Diameter | Ø80 mm (chromium-nickel steel) |
| Draft Shield Height | 240 mm |
| Net Weight | 5.9 kg |
| Calibration | Internal or external |
Overview
The Precisa XS125A Analytical Balance is a high-precision laboratory instrument engineered for demanding mass measurement applications in research laboratories, quality control environments, and regulated pharmaceutical and chemical production facilities. Based on electromagnetic force compensation (EMFC) technology, the XS125A delivers stable, drift-resistant measurements with a readability of 0.1 mg across its full 125 g capacity. Its robust mechanical architecture—featuring a monolithic weighing cell, chromium-nickel steel pan (Ø80 mm), and integrated draft shield (240 mm height)—ensures mechanical stability and minimizes environmental interference. Designed and manufactured in Switzerland, the balance complies with international metrological standards including OIML R76-1 and EN 45501, and supports traceable calibration protocols required under ISO/IEC 17025, USP , and EU GMP Annex 11.
Key Features
- Fluorescent display with wide viewing angle and ambient-light-independent legibility—optimized for low-light lab benches and multi-operator environments.
- Three-step adjustable stability setting allows users to configure response speed versus noise rejection based on sample volatility, air currents, or vibration conditions.
- Automatic power-on at mains restoration and programmable auto-off (user-selectable idle timeout) reduce energy consumption and extend component lifetime without compromising operational readiness.
- Internal calibration mode supports user-initiated adjustment using built-in reference masses; external calibration is fully compatible with standard weights—including the supplied F1-class 100 g certified reference weight (calibration certificate issued by Shanghai Technical Supervision Bureau).
- Electromagnetic compatibility (EMC) certified per IEC 61326-1; operating temperature range of 0–40 °C ensures consistent performance in non-climate-controlled labs or cleanroom antechambers.
- Low power draw (6 VA) and dual-voltage capability (115/230 V AC, 50–60 Hz) enable global deployment without transformer dependency.
Sample Compatibility & Compliance
The XS125A accommodates a broad range of sample forms—from powders and granules to small-volume liquids in tared vessels—thanks to its large-diameter pan and optimized draft shield geometry. The Ø80 mm stainless-steel pan resists corrosion from common solvents and cleaning agents. All firmware and hardware configurations meet regulatory requirements for data integrity: audit trail logging (with timestamped event records), user access levels, and password-protected parameter changes align with FDA 21 CFR Part 11 and EU Annex 11 expectations. Routine verification procedures can be documented per ASTM E898 or ISO 17034 guidelines when used with certified reference materials.
Software & Data Management
The balance features RS232 and optional USB interfaces for direct connection to LIMS, ELN, or MES platforms. Data output follows standardized ASCII format with configurable delimiters and prefix/suffix identifiers (e.g., sample ID, operator code, date/time stamp). Optional PC software enables real-time graphing, statistical analysis (mean, SD, CV%), GLP-compliant report generation, and automated export to CSV or PDF. All measurement events—including calibration, tare, zero, and stability triggers—are logged with immutable timestamps and operator IDs where authentication is enabled.

FAQ
Is the XS125A compliant with ISO/IEC 17025 calibration requirements?
Yes—the balance supports documented calibration using traceable standards, and its linearity (±0.2 mg), reproducibility (≤0.1 mg), and sensitivity drift (±2 ppm/°C) fall within acceptable tolerances for accredited testing laboratories.
Does the included 100 g weight satisfy national metrological verification requirements outside China?
The F1-class weight is accompanied by a certificate traceable to NIM (China National Institute of Metrology); for use in EU or US labs, users should verify equivalency via MRA signatory NMIs or perform local recalibration.
Can the fluorescent display be replaced with an LCD option?
No—the XS125A is offered exclusively with the high-contrast fluorescent display as standard; no LCD variant exists in this model series.
What is the recommended recalibration interval under GLP conditions?
Precisa recommends daily verification with check weights and formal recalibration every 3–6 months, depending on usage frequency, environmental stability, and risk assessment per ISO/IEC 17025 Clause 6.5.
Is the draft shield removable for cleaning or large-sample accommodation?
Yes—the acrylic draft shield is tool-free detachable and designed for routine decontamination without affecting mechanical alignment or calibration integrity.
